About the role
As our Environmental Assistant Team Leader, you will:
- Lead a flexible and responsive multi-disciplinary team to ensure the environmental quality of all Vico Homes neighbourhoods is maintained to a high standard.
- Support the team by planning work such as garden clearances, litter picking, clearing rubbish, chainsaw work, tidying communal land and checking areas regularly to maintain high standards.
- Work with internal teams, external partners, and contractors to coordinate and deliver estate-based environmental services.
- Respond to emergency situations, including out-of-hours work as needed, and participate in a standby/call-out rota during periods of adverse weather.
- Develop and manage a cost-effective and efficient Environmental Team, focused on delivering positive outcomes for our estates.
- Ensure full compliance with health and safety requirements, including training, machinery servicing, fleet management, and daily equipment checks.
